T-Mobile myTouch 4G Slide now available in stores for $199

July 27, 2011 by Marin Perez - Leave a Comment

T-Mobile myTouch 4G Slide out now
Share on Twitter Share on Facebook ( 0 shares )

The T-Mobile myTouch 4G Slide is finally available to purchase from T-Mobile and this Android handset packs a full QWERTY keyboard, the latest version of Android and a world-class camera for about $200 on a new, two-year contract.

With a 3.7-inch display, dual-core Snapdragon processor and all the goodies you’d expect from a modern smartphone, the myTouch 4G Slide is definitely packing the goods when it comes to hardware. The full QWERTY keyboard wasn’t quite as good as the previous version but it’s definitely good enough to get the job done. We’re not in love with the Genius button replacing the search button but some of you may love the voice-recognition technology.

Of course, the real star of the show with the myTouch 4G Slide is the 8-megapixel camera which has virtually no shutter lag in the normal modes. We put this camera up against the iPhone 4 – the most popular camera on Flickr now – and it definitely produced clearer shots.

If you’re still hesitant to pick up the myTouch 4G Slide, you can check out our official review where we said:

The power under the hood of the myTouch 4G Slide should appeal to the spec-junkies out there, the keyboard will attract the power users, and the camera should satisfy amateur photographers and those who share pictures to social networks constantly. Even if you’re not in one of these categories, the myTouch 4G Slide is still a device that’s worth a look.
If you’re looking for a powerful handset on T-Mobile and aren’t sold on the Sensation or need a physical keyboard, then be sure to grab the myTouch 4G Slide.
